Ohio State women edge Wisconsin 1-0 to claim Frozen Four championship

Wisconsin goaltender Ava McNaughton (30) deflects a goal attempt in the second period of an NCAA college women's championship hockey game against the Ohio State, Sunday, March 24, 2024, in Durham, N.H. (AP Photo/Steven Senne)

DURHAM, N.H. (AP) — Joy Dunne scored the only goal of the match with 7:12 remaining to spark top-seeded Ohio State to a 1-0 victory over defending-champion and second-seeded Wisconsin in the final of the women's Frozen Four at the Whittemore Center Arena on Sunday.

Dunne used assists from Hannah Bilka and Cayla Barnes to help the Buckeyes avenge a 1-0 loss to Wisconsin in last season's championship game. Ohio State (35-4) set a school record for wins in slipping past the Badgers (35-6). It is the second championship for the Buckeyes, who won their first in 2022 with a 3-2 victory over Minnesota-Duluth.
